I used ozone on my 225.
 
I think it helps with water clarity and will make your skimmer more effective (if you run the O3 through the skimmer).
 
Right now I don't have plans to use ozone on my new setup.
 
I always recommend a controller on tanks of less than 125 gal, or if your ozone unit is not adjustable for output. I just think it is safer that way.

I ran ozone for many years until I started probiotics/vodka dosing.  Fearing the ozone would kill off beneficial bacteria, I discontinued its use.  Knock on wood, since the switch in approx. Sept. '10, things have never been better.
